Selecting the Right Wall Surface



Selecting the optimum wall surface to act as an accent in an area requires cautious factor to consider of aspects such as lighting, space layout, and focal points. When figuring out the best wall for an accent, it is important to examine the all-natural and artificial lights in the area. A well-lit wall surface can boost the accent shade, while a darker location might not do it justice.



Additionally, the format of the area plays a considerable function. Selecting a wall surface that naturally attracts the eye can create an unified circulation in the room. Take into consideration wall surfaces that are directly visible upon going into the space or those that enhance existing focal points like fireplaces or huge home windows.

Additionally, understanding the space's objective is important in choosing the appropriate wall surface for an accent. In living https://www.hellomagazine.com/homes/2019052373394/kirstie-allsopp-decorating-advice-grey-paint/ , for instance, the wall surface behind the primary seating area is frequently selected to develop a prime focus. On the other hand, in rooms, the wall behind the bed is a preferred choice for an accent, including deepness and visual rate of interest to the space.

Picking the Perfect Shade



When considering the ideal color for an accent wall, it is vital to take into consideration the existing shade combination of the room and the preferred atmosphere. The shade you choose ought to complement the total style of the room while including aesthetic rate of interest.

One technique is to pick a color that is already present in the room, maybe in a furniture or an art piece, to create a cohesive look. Conversely, you can opt for a different color to make a bold declaration and develop a prime focus in the area.

Cozy tones like terracotta or mustard can include comfort, while cooler tones like navy or emerald green can bring a sense of class. It is essential to take into consideration the room's lighting as well. Dark shades can make a space feel smaller, while light shades can produce a sense of visibility.

Experience the selected shade on the wall and observe just how it transforms throughout the day with varying light problems. Bear in mind, the ideal color is one that not just looks great by itself however additionally boosts the overall aesthetic of the room.

Balancing Patterns and Structures



To achieve an unified appearance when including accent walls, it is critical to meticulously balance using patterns and textures within the room. When choosing patterns for an accent wall surface, consider the existing patterns in the area. If the area already has bold patterns in furnishings or decor, opt for an extra subtle pattern on the accent wall to prevent frustrating the room.

Alternatively, if the space is mostly single or ordinary, a lively pattern on the accent wall surface can add rate of interest and depth to the space.

Structures play a vital role in developing an aesthetically attractive space too. Mixing various appearances includes measurement and richness to the space. For example, matching a smooth, glossy accent wall surface with a deluxe, textured rug can produce a vibrant comparison.

It is necessary to strike a balance between different textures to avoid the room from feeling also hectic or disjointed.
